Understanding Minimally Processed Dog Food
Minimally processed dog food refers to pet food that has undergone the least amount of alteration from its natural state. This means using whole ingredients like fresh meats, vegetables, and fruits, and employing cooking methods such as steaming or gentle baking rather than high-heat extrusion common in kibble. The goal is to preserve the natural nutrients, enzymes, and beneficial compounds found in the raw ingredients, leading to better digestibility and overall health for the dog.

Q5: What is the difference between "fresh" and "minimally processed" dog food?
A5: While often used interchangeably, "fresh" typically refers to the food being refrigerated or frozen and not shelf-stable, while "minimally processed" describes the method of preparation, emphasizing gentle cooking and whole ingredients.
Q6: Are minimally processed foods more expensive than traditional kibble?
A6: Generally, yes, minimally processed and fresh dog foods tend to be more expensive due to the higher quality of ingredients and specialized preparation methods. However, the health benefits can sometimes lead to lower veterinary costs in the long run.
Q7: How do I transition my dog to a new food?
A7: It's recommended to transition your dog gradually over 7-10 days. Start by mixing a small amount of the new food with their old food, gradually increasing the proportion of the new food while decreasing the old.
